About Pasbela Village
Pasbela is a small village in Jaleswar tehsil, in the district of Baleshwar,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 5, made up of 2 males and 3 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,500 females per 1000 males. The village covers 4 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 756084,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Pasbela
The census records public bus service for Pasbela as Available within <5 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
